Particle
.news
Government
❯
International Relations
❯
Middle East Politics
❯
Iranian Politics
Political Leverage
18 ARTICLES
3mo ago
Italy Faces Diplomatic Dilemma Over Journalist Detained in Iran and Drone Engineer Held in Milan